A judge will set the deadline if the tenant must transfer out. This deadline can be set with the judicial officer within the hearing, or it may be based on state legislation. Some states make it possible for tenants different amounts of time to maneuver out depending on the basis for the eviction.

In certain states with chilly winters, you may be able to have the eviction postponed on that basis. To get a postponement, you continue to must prove that you would probably go through an Severe hardship and at least can continue on paying out the hire.

Eviction lawsuits are heard in a formal trial courtroom in a few states, in a little promises court docket in Other people, or in both location in however Other individuals. In case the landlord can opt for which location to employ, their choice might rely on simply how much lease you owe, which could acquire the situation outside the house the financial Restrict of little claims court.

Or maybe the landlord's illegal habits, which include not maintaining the rental property in habitable condition, will serve as a good defense, as would a claim which the eviction lawsuit is in retaliation for your personal insistence on needed, major repairs.

The grievance would be the doc that a landlord employs to start out an eviction continuing. It contains the grounds for your eviction and also the remedies that the landlord desires the court to order, like shifting out, having to pay back rent, and compensating for damages brought on by remaining around the home. Every other concerns, including home injury, typically has to be tackled inside a separate proceeding.
